A matter of taste.

March 19, 2011 17 Comments

Grant asked for a quesadilla for lunch. I made him one and added a little side of tortilla chips.

Grant: “These chips are too spicy.”
Me: “The chips…? The chips are too spicy..?!”
Grant: “Yes.”
Me: “Not the quesadilla… but the chips are too spicy..?”
Grant: “Yes.”
Me: “You’re weird.”
Grant: (slightly confused) “I thought you said I was interesting….”

That too, Buddy. That too.
